Stepping into Cafe Du Nord feels like entering a San Francisco institution where every corner echoes with stories of live music and community spirit. This iconic venue has hosted countless debut performances for regional bands, giving local talent a well-deserved spotlight. The outdoor patio adds a chill vibe, perfect for sipping a drink and soaking in the atmosphere, whether you're catching an intimate acoustic set or a high-energy indie show. It’s not just about the music though, Cafe Du Nord really fosters a sense of connection, often hosting events like Battle of the Bands that really bring the community together. You can settle into the cozy bar seating without missing a beat, or take a breather in the lounge when things get lively.
